Hypertrophy: The Path to Muscle Mastery
Embark on a journey for muscular dominance through the science of hypertrophy. This mechanism involves your deliberate growth of muscle fibers, resulting in sculpted physiques and enhanced strength. To optimize your gains, implement progressive overload, a cornerstone concept that requires continually testing your muscles with heavier weights or increased resistance. Fuel your growth with an adequate amount of protein and carbohydrates to support muscle repair and synthesis.
- Additionally, prioritize recovery as your muscles need time to regrow after strenuous workouts.
- Dedication is key to achieving lasting hypertrophy, so keep determined to your training routine.
Ultimately, by following these principles, you can harness the power of hypertrophy and transform your body into a majestic testament to dedication and hard work.

The Art and Science
Achieving significant muscle hypertrophy requires a deep understanding of both the artistic and scientific principles involved. While genetics undoubtedly plays to an individual's potential, dedicated training regimens combined with strategic nutritional methods are essential for maximizing muscle growth. Progressive overload, the gradual increment of weight or resistance over time, is paramount in stimulating muscle development. Furthermore, adequate rest and recovery periods are crucial to allow your muscles to repair and strengthen after intense workouts. By optimizing these elements, you can effectively shape a physique that reflects both your dedication and understanding of this complex process.
